Buchanania lanzan Spreng

 
  • Family : ANACARDIACEAE
    (Cashew Or Mango Or Sumac Family)
  • Family (Hindi name) : AAM FAMILY (आम फैमिली)
  • Family (as per The APG System III) : ANACARDIACEAE
  • Synonym(s) : Buchanania latifolia Roxb.
  • Species Name (as per The Plant List) : Buchanania cochinchinensis (Lour.) M.R.Almeida
  • Common name : Calumpong nut, Almondette tree, Cheronjee, Cuddapah almond
  • Vernacular name : Chironji, Piyal, Piar, Char (Hindi); Charoli, Kole maavu, Murkali (Kannada); Saraiparuppu, Moraetha, Morala, Mudaima, Moraimaram (Tamil); Sarapappu, Morli, Sara, Jarumamidi (Telugu); Char (Oria); Priyala (Sanskrit); Charoli (Marathi); Kalamavu, Moongapezhu, Mungapera, Mural, Nuruvei, Nuramaram, Nooramaram Padacheru, Priyalam (Malayalam)
  • Habit : Tree
  • Habitat : Deciduous forests
  • Comments / notes : Occasional on hills up to 1400m. Moist deciduous, dry deciduous and semi-evergreen forests. The kernels are used in sweetmeats.
  • Key identification features : Bark tessellated in prominent squares. Drupes ovoid-oblong, black when ripe.
  • Flower, Fruit : January-May
  • Distribution :
    • Andhra Pradesh : Vishakapatnam district, East Godavari district, Kurnool district, Prakasam district. Srikakulam district, West Godavari district
    • Kerala : Wayanad district, Malappuram district, Palakkad district, Idukki district, Pathanamthitta district, Kollam district, Thiruvananthapuram district
    • Maharashtra : Akola district
    • Odisha : Common in forests, Mayurbhanj district
    • Tamil Nadu : All districts of Tamil Nadu
  • World Distribution : India, Myanmar, Sri Lanka
  • Conservation Status : Not Evaluated (NE)
